Living in Findlay Creek: Ottawa’s Fastest-Growing Family Suburb

Over the past decade, Findlay Creek has transformed from quiet farmland into one of Ottawa’s most vibrant and fastest-growing suburban communities. Located in the south end near Bank Street and Leitrim Road, this master-planned neighborhood has become a magnet for young families, first-time buyers, and newcomers looking for modern homes, family-friendly amenities, and room to grow.

In 2025, Findlay Creek continues to boom — with new builds, expanding schools, and plenty of suburban conveniences. Here’s why more families are choosing to call it home.


A Hub of New Builds and Modern Homes

One of the biggest attractions of Findlay Creek is its selection of new-build homes. Unlike older Ottawa suburbs, most of the housing here has been constructed within the last 15 years, offering:

  • Detached Homes with open layouts, energy-efficient systems, and spacious yards.

  • Townhomes ideal for first-time buyers and young professionals who want affordability without sacrificing space.

  • Semi-detached options that balance cost and comfort.

Developers like Tamarack and Tartan continue to expand the community, so buyers still have opportunities to purchase pre-construction homes or move-in-ready builds. This makes Findlay Creek especially appealing for those who want modern finishes without the need for renovations.


Schools and Family-Friendly Appeal

Families are the heartbeat of Findlay Creek. The community has already welcomed brand-new elementary schools with both English and French options, and more schools are planned as the population grows.

Parents love Findlay Creek for:

  • Safe, quiet residential streets.

  • Playgrounds and splash pads throughout the community.

  • Easy access to École secondaire catholique Franco-Cité and other nearby secondary schools.

It’s not unusual to see kids biking to school, parents pushing strollers, or neighbors gathering at local parks — making Findlay Creek feel like a true family-centered suburb.


Suburban Amenities Close to Home

Despite being a newer suburb, Findlay Creek has quickly built up its own amenities. Residents enjoy:

  • Findlay Creek Centre – Home to groceries, restaurants, fitness studios, and coffee shops.

  • Medical and dental clinics – Conveniently located for growing families.

  • Community events hosted by the Findlay Creek Community Association.

For larger shopping trips, residents head to South Keys or Hunt Club, just a short drive away.


Green Spaces and Outdoor Living

Findlay Creek may be growing fast, but it hasn’t lost its connection to nature. The community is bordered by the Leitrim Wetlands, offering trails and birdwatching opportunities. Local parks and walking paths are integrated throughout the neighborhood, encouraging an active lifestyle.

For families who value outdoor space, Findlay Creek provides the best of both worlds — suburban comfort and access to nature.


Transportation and Commute

Findlay Creek is conveniently located near Bank Street and Leitrim Road, making it easy to access downtown Ottawa in about 25–35 minutes by car.

Transit options are expanding too:

  • OC Transpo routes connect the community to South Keys and beyond.

  • The future Leitrim LRT station (part of Ottawa’s Stage 2 expansion) will provide faster, car-free access to downtown, making Findlay Creek even more attractive for commuters.
